Hampel Oil Distributors, Inc. is a family-owned and operated wholesale marketer and distributor of finished petroleum products that was started in 1976 by Al Hampel. Now with 21 locations in 7 states Hampel Oil continues to grow! Above all, we value Safety, Customer Service, Continuous Learning, Respect, and Value Creation.
